Hasiya Population - Jaunpur, Uttar Pradesh

Hasiya is a large village located in Mariahu Tehsil of Jaunpur district, Uttar Pradesh with total 494 families residing. The Hasiya village has population of 3392 of which 1568 are males while 1824 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Hasiya village population of children with age 0-6 is 518 which makes up 15.27 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Hasiya village is 1163 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Hasiya as per census is 933,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.

Hasiya village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Hasiya village was 68.68 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Hasiya Male literacy stands at 83.85 % while female literacy rate was 56.16 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 12.09 % of total population in Hasiya village. The village Hasiya curr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Hasiya village out of total population, 1431 were engaged in work activities. 32.56 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 67.44 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 1431 workers engaged in Main Work, 323 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 15 were Agricultural labourer.
